We will be posting regular quiz questions to win prizes over the coming weeks — some harder than others — but all a bit of fun to keep you in a good musical mood at home

Thanks to our friends at Band Supplies we have a fantastic Rosetti Series 5 alto trombone — the perfect instrument for children to learn on. It comes in a lacquered finish with black case.

All you have to do is come up with the link between the following — and explain why?

Question:

What's the link between a former husband of Marilyn Monroe, a character in the children's television programme 'Camberwick Green', the captain of the 1983 Aberdeen football team that won the European Cup Winner's Cup... and a famous American big-band leader played on film by actor James Stewart?
